When we think of luxury, we usually think of huge houses sitting on massive acres of land. We rarely think of condos, although condos can at times be far more luxurious than houses and Toronto is home to many expensive condos.
As a city with a highly-developed real estate market, Toronto has some of the most stunning and luxurious condo residences. Oftentimes, condo prices surpass the princess of houses because of the luxury features and desirable locations they are in.
To give you an idea of how far their splendour goes and why they are so sought-after, we will go through the ten most expensive condos in Toronto currently for sale (as of July 20th, 2021).
1. #703-118 Yorkville Ave, Toronto
Asking price: $18,690,000

The Details
- Property Taxes: $47,024
- Size: 6300 sqft
- Bedrooms: 3+1
- Bathrooms: 5
- # Days on the Market: 9
One of the most exclusive condo residences located in one of the most prestigious Toronto hotels awaits its new owner! The Hazelton Hotel residence is the most expensive condo in Toronto on the market today. This one-of-a-kind condo features some impressive elements made by expert artisans to blend classical renaissance and modern design perfectly. The details in every room are immaculate and give a sophisticated but homey feeling anyone would enjoy.
By purchasing this unit, you get a private elevator leading to your condo only, nine rooms, six balconies with stunning views, a wine cellar, and four parking spaces. Nothing is overlooked in this Hazelton Hotel condo, so every amenity will be at your fingertips, including room service, health club, spa, restaurant, screening room, housekeeping, pool, as well as house limo and driver services.
2. 8002 – 1 Bloor Street W, Toronto
Asking price: $16,416,626

The Details
- Property Taxes: $NA
- Size: 4250-4499 sqft
- Bedrooms: 3+1
- Bathrooms: 4
- # Days on the Market: 129
Brand new and very luxurious are the two words that perfectly describe this penthouse. Sitting on the 80th floor of Canada’s tallest residential superstructure, “Mizrahi’s The One,” this condo is a true engineering marvel. It spans half of the building, facing south, west, and north to give residents unobstructed sunset views that simply take your breath away. Some of the other highlights worth mentioning here are the two fireplaces, marble bathtub, gas cooktop and stone counters.
As the building was just recently built, it’s packed with modern, high-tech features that have been thoroughly tested. A sky lobby, spa lounge, valet parking, fitness facility, outdoor amenity terrace, and a heated infinity pool are also part of the building.
